SC-900 Practice Question: Describe the capabilities of Microsoft compliance solutions
You are designing a compliance solution for a global company. You need to ensure that data stored in SharePoint Online is not accessible from a specific geographic region. Which Microsoft Purview feature should you use?
⚠ Common exam trap
The trap is that candidates often mistakenly believe Compliance boundaries can control data access by location, when in fact they are limited to eDiscovery and audit scoping. For geographic access restrictions, you would need Conditional Access (Entra ID) or Multi-Geo, which are not Purview features.

This question is problematic because no Microsoft Purview feature listed directly restricts SharePoint Online data access based on geographic region. Compliance boundaries (A) are for eDiscovery scoping, not access control. Data loss prevention policies (B) prevent data loss but do not block access by region. Retention policies (C) manage data lifecycle, not access. Sensitivity labels (D) classify and protect data but cannot enforce geographic restrictions on their own. For this requirement, you would use a non-Purview feature such as Conditional Access in Microsoft Entra ID or Multi-Geo capabilities.

SharePoint Online is a cloud-based collaboration platform from Microsoft that lets teams create, store, organize, and share content securely from anywhere.

Least privilege
Least privilege is a security principle that means giving users, systems, or programs only the minimum permissions they need to do their job and nothing more.
